This review is from: MiG-19 Farmer in Action - Aircraft No. 143 (Paperback)
MiG Design Bureau first shocked the world with the infamous MiG-15 during the Korean War. The Soviets continued development of this concept with the MiG-17 and then the first Soviet supersonic plane, the MiG-19. "Farmer" is the NATO code word used for this plane.
Not as many MiG-19's were built as the MiG-15, but this was a very capable and dangerous opponent. Fast, maneuverable, easy to manufacture, this plane gave US pilots a tough time during the Vietnam War and the Israelis in 1967/73 Wars.
This is another in the fine series of "In Action" books, Squadron Signal format is to provide the readers with a bit of narrative, plenty of clear black and white photos, and many line drawings to show each version of this fighter. 2 pages of color plates help the modelers see the different paint schemes used.
This book is perfect for modelers or those who are interested in an introduction to Soviet aviation history. Yefim Gorden wrote the definative book on the Mig-19, but it more expensive. I highly recommend this book, I have read it and referenced it many times.

This review is from: MiG-19 Farmer in Action - Aircraft No. 143 (Paperback)
This is a typical high quality photo essay from Signal Publications. The MiG 19 Farmer was a relatively low production Soviet designed aircraft, and unbeknownst to most, the first supersonic fighter. It was widely produced by the Chinese and sold to their client-states such as Pakistan, North Vietnam, and several African countries.
The photos, the backbone of this type publication, are uniformly excellent. There is good technical data to make this a useful tool for modellers as well as aviation buffs.
